  • 目的: 探究聚乙二醇双丙烯酸酯复合物水凝胶降解物质对鼻黏膜纤毛传输系统的影响。方法:实验根据不同配比将聚乙二醇双丙烯酸酯、壳聚糖、聚乙烯醇材料通过光交联形成复合物水凝胶,根据国际通行医疗器械生物学评价标准将聚乙二醇双丙烯酸酯复合物水凝胶材料、明胶海绵材料、壳聚糖材料配制成浸提液。实验分为聚乙二醇双丙烯酸酯复合物水凝胶材料组(A组)、明胶海绵材料组(B组)、壳聚糖材料组(C组)及对照组(D组),因各填塞材料用DMEM/F12:BEGM培养液浸提,故选用DMEM/F12:BEGM培养液作对照。取人鼻腔钩突组织,经气液界面培养。高速数字显微视频成像系统检测纤毛摆动频率,分别测量加药前基础状态(0 min)及加药后1 h、1 d、2 d、3 d内的CBF。结果: ①A、B、C、D组随着天数增加,纤毛摆动频率均呈现先增加后减慢的趋势。②A组与其他各组相比,纤毛摆动频率数值变化最大(P<0.05),提示聚乙二醇双丙烯酸酯复合物水凝胶材料可使纤毛摆动频率增加。③B、C、D组间的最大增加量与最大减少量相比,差异无统计学意义(P>0.05),提示可吸收性明胶海绵材料和可吸收性壳聚糖材料对鼻黏膜纤毛活性无影响。结论: 聚乙二醇双丙烯酸酯复合物水凝胶材料可使体外气液界面培养的鼻黏膜上皮细胞纤毛摆动频率增加,从而使鼻黏膜纤毛活性增强,因此可以满足该新材料临床应用的安全性评价需求。
